/*  Define the externally visible functions in this file.
 */
#define PAM_SM_ACCOUNT
#include <security/pam_modules.h>
#include <security/_pam_macros.h>


/* Define the functions to be called before and after load since _init
 * and _fini are obsolete, and their use can lead to unpredicatable
 * results.
 */
void __attribute__ ((constructor)) libpam_slurm_init(void);
void __attribute__ ((destructor)) libpam_slurm_fini(void);

/*
 *  Handle for libslurm.so
 *
 *  We open libslurm.so via dlopen () in order to pass the
 *   flag RTDL_GLOBAL so that subsequently loaded modules have
 *   access to libslurm symbols. This is pretty much only needed
 *   for dynamically loaded modules that would otherwise be
 *   linked against libslurm.
 *
 */
static void * slurm_h = NULL;

/* This function is necessary because libpam_slurm_init is called without access
 * to the pam handle.
 */
static void
_log_msg(int level, const char *format, ...)
{
	va_list args;

	openlog(PAM_MODULE_NAME, LOG_CONS | LOG_PID, LOG_AUTHPRIV);
	va_start(args, format);
	vsyslog(level, format, args);
	va_end(args);
	closelog();
	return;
}

/*
 *  Sends a message to the application informing the user
 *  that access was denied due to Slurm.
 */
extern void
send_user_msg(pam_handle_t *pamh, const char *mesg)
{
	int retval;
	struct pam_conv *conv;
	void *dummy;    /* needed to eliminate warning:
			 * dereferencing type-punned pointer will
			 * break strict-aliasing rules */
	struct pam_message msg[1];
	const struct pam_message *pmsg[1];
	struct pam_response *prsp;

	info("send_user_msg: %s", mesg);
	/*  Get conversation function to talk with app.
	 */
	retval = pam_get_item(pamh, PAM_CONV, (const void **) &dummy);
	conv = (struct pam_conv *) dummy;
	if (retval != PAM_SUCCESS) {
		_log_msg(LOG_ERR, "unable to get pam_conv: %s",
			 pam_strerror(pamh, retval));
		return;
	}

	/*  Construct msg to send to app.
	 */
	msg[0].msg_style = PAM_ERROR_MSG;
	msg[0].msg = mesg;
	pmsg[0] = &msg[0];
	prsp = NULL;

	/*  Send msg to app and free the (meaningless) rsp.
	 */
	retval = conv->conv(1, pmsg, &prsp, conv->appdata_ptr);
	if (retval != PAM_SUCCESS)
		_log_msg(LOG_ERR, "unable to converse with app: %s",
			 pam_strerror(pamh, retval));
	if (prsp != NULL)
		_pam_drop_reply(prsp, 1);

	return;
}

/*
 * Dynamically open system's libslurm.so with RTLD_GLOBAL flag.
 * This allows subsequently loaded modules access to libslurm symbols.
 */
extern void libpam_slurm_init (void)
{
	char libslurmname[64];

	if (slurm_h)
		return;

	/* First try to use the same libslurm version ("libslurm.so.24.0.0"),
	 * Second try to match the major version number ("libslurm.so.24"),
	 * Otherwise use "libslurm.so" */
	if (snprintf(libslurmname, sizeof(libslurmname),
			"libslurm.so.%d.%d.%d", SLURM_API_CURRENT,
			SLURM_API_REVISION, SLURM_API_AGE) >=
			(signed) sizeof(libslurmname) ) {
		_log_msg (LOG_ERR, "Unable to write libslurmname\n");
	} else if ((slurm_h = dlopen(libslurmname, RTLD_NOW|RTLD_GLOBAL))) {
		return;
	} else {
		_log_msg (LOG_INFO, "Unable to dlopen %s: %s\n",
			libslurmname, dlerror ());
	}

	if (snprintf(libslurmname, sizeof(libslurmname), "libslurm.so.%d",
			SLURM_API_CURRENT) >= (signed) sizeof(libslurmname) ) {
		_log_msg (LOG_ERR, "Unable to write libslurmname\n");
	} else if ((slurm_h = dlopen(libslurmname, RTLD_NOW|RTLD_GLOBAL))) {
		return;
	} else {
		_log_msg (LOG_INFO, "Unable to dlopen %s: %s\n",
			libslurmname, dlerror ());
	}

	if (!(slurm_h = dlopen("libslurm.so", RTLD_NOW|RTLD_GLOBAL))) {
		_log_msg (LOG_ERR, "Unable to dlopen libslurm.so: %s\n",
			  dlerror ());
	}

	return;
}

extern void libpam_slurm_fini (void)
{
	if (slurm_h)
		dlclose (slurm_h);
	return;
}
